World Cup’s Most Original Squad Videos: Which One Stands Out?
National federations are turning to inventive video concepts to unveil their 26‑player squads for the 2026 World Cup. France channels a nostalgic 1990s American TV vibe, while England pays homage to the Beatles.
Argentina’s coach Scaloni showcases the country’s landscapes in a travel‑style clip. Spain includes a royal endorsement from King Felipe VI, and Senegal embraces tribal visuals.
Each video aims to capture global attention in an era of viral marketing. Which presentation resonates the most with fans?
